diff --git a/lib/Locale/Po4a/Man.pm b/lib/Locale/Po4a/Man.pm index ff4157d3d..dd43d0ec4 100644 --- a/lib/Locale/Po4a/Man.pm +++ b/lib/Locale/Po4a/Man.pm @@ -393,7 +393,6 @@ under the terms of GPL v2.0 or later (see the COPYING file). =cut package Locale::Po4a::Man; -use DynaLoader; use 5.16.0; use strict; @@ -401,7 +400,7 @@ use warnings; require Exporter; use vars qw(@ISA @EXPORT); -@ISA = qw(Locale::Po4a::TransTractor DynaLoader); +@ISA = qw(Locale::Po4a::TransTractor); @EXPORT = qw(); # new initialize); # Try to use a C extension if present. diff --git a/lib/Locale/Po4a/Po.pm b/lib/Locale/Po4a/Po.pm index 3da2c8855..92d916981 100644 --- a/lib/Locale/Po4a/Po.pm +++ b/lib/Locale/Po4a/Po.pm @@ -101,13 +101,12 @@ use IO::File; require Exporter; package Locale::Po4a::Po; -use DynaLoader; use Locale::Po4a::Common qw(wrap_msg wrap_mod wrap_ref_mod dgettext); use subs qw(makespace); use vars qw(@ISA @EXPORT_OK); -@ISA = qw(Exporter DynaLoader); +@ISA = qw(Exporter); @EXPORT = qw(%debug); @EXPORT_OK = qw(&move_po_if_needed); diff --git a/lib/Locale/Po4a/TransTractor.pm b/lib/Locale/Po4a/TransTractor.pm index 7b6112433..53356b13b 100644 --- a/lib/Locale/Po4a/TransTractor.pm +++ b/lib/Locale/Po4a/TransTractor.pm @@ -3,7 +3,6 @@ require Exporter; package Locale::Po4a::TransTractor; -use DynaLoader; sub import { } @@ -12,9 +11,8 @@ use strict; use warnings; use subs qw(makespace); -use vars qw($VERSION @ISA @EXPORT); +use vars qw($VERSION @EXPORT); $VERSION = "0.74-alpha"; -@ISA = qw(DynaLoader); @EXPORT = qw(new process translate read write readpo writepo getpoout setpoout get_in_charset get_out_charset handle_yaml);